版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
产品开发过程管理综合模板一、适用场景与价值本模板适用于各类企业或团队进行产品开发的全流程管理,尤其适合以下场景:初创企业:从0到1搭建产品时,需规范需求到上线的流程,避免开发混乱;成熟企业:多产品线并行开发时,统一管理标准,提升跨部门协作效率;跨职能团队:产品、研发、设计、测试、运营等角色协同工作时,明确职责与节点;复杂项目:涉及多模块、长周期、高风险的产品开发,需通过流程管控降低试错成本。通过标准化模板,可实现需求可追溯、进度可视、风险可控,保证产品按时、按质交付,同时沉淀开发经验,支撑后续迭代优化。二、全流程操作步骤详解产品开发过程可分为需求分析、产品设计、开发实施、测试验证、上线发布、复盘优化六大阶段,每个阶段的核心任务、操作要点及负责人(一)需求分析阶段:明确“做什么”目标:收集、分析、确认用户需求,输出清晰、可执行的需求文档,避免后期返工。1.需求收集任务:通过多渠道获取用户、市场、业务方的需求输入。操作:用户调研:通过问卷、访谈、用户行为数据分析(如数据分析团队提供的使用报告),挖掘用户痛点(例:“希望简化注册流程”);市场分析:研究竞品功能(如竞品分析小组输出《竞品功能对比表》),识别差异化机会;业务方需求:对接市场部、销售部,明确业务目标(例:“新功能需支持3个月内提升用户留存率5%”)。输出物:《原始需求清单》(含需求来源、描述、提出人)。2.需求分析与筛选任务:评估需求合理性、优先级及可行性,剔除无效需求。操作:使用“KANO模型”区分基本型、期望型、兴奋型需求,结合“价值-成本矩阵”排序(高价值、低成本优先);技术可行性评估:研发负责人确认需求是否现有技术可实现,是否存在技术瓶颈;资源匹配度:项目经理评估人力、时间、预算是否支持需求落地。输出物:《需求优先级评估表》(含需求ID、描述、优先级、可行性结论、负责部门)。3.需求文档编写任务:将筛选后的需求转化为结构化文档,明确功能边界、验收标准。操作:产品经理*编写《产品需求文档(PRD)》,包含:需求背景、用户画像、功能详述(用户故事、流程图、原型图)、非功能需求(功能、安全)、验收标准(例:“注册流程需≤3步,错误提示≤2秒”);附《需求变更记录表》,记录需求变更原因、影响范围、审批人。输出物:《PRD文档》《需求变更记录表》。4.需求评审任务:组织跨部门评审,保证需求理解一致,避免歧义。操作:参与人员:产品经理、研发负责人、设计负责人、测试负责人、业务方代表(如市场部经理);评审要点:需求完整性(是否覆盖用户核心场景)、逻辑一致性(流程是否闭环)、可测试性(验收标准是否量化);评审输出:签字确认的《需求评审报告》,明确“通过”“修改后通过”“不通过”结论及整改项。(二)产品设计阶段:规划“怎么做”目标:将需求转化为具体设计方案,保证用户体验与开发可行性。1.原型与视觉设计任务:输出可交互原型及UI设计稿,明确产品界面与交互逻辑。操作:交互设计:交互设计师根据PRD绘制低保真原型(Axure/Figma),标注核心交互流程(如“用户按钮后跳转至支付页”);视觉设计:UI设计师基于品牌规范,输出高保真设计稿,包含页面布局、色彩、字体、图标等;设计评审:组织产品、研发、测试评审原型,重点检查交互合理性、视觉一致性。输出物:《交互原型图》《UI设计稿》《设计评审报告》。2.技术方案设计任务:研发团队制定技术实现方案,明确架构、技术栈、接口等。操作:架构设计:技术架构师输出《系统架构图》,确定前端(React/Vue)、后端(Java/Python)、数据库(MySQL/MongoDB)等技术选型;接口设计:后端开发定义API接口文档(Swagger格式),包含请求参数、返回格式、错误码;数据库设计:数据库工程师设计ER图,明确表结构、字段类型、索引策略。输出物:《技术方案说明书》《API接口文档》《数据库设计文档》。(三)开发实施阶段:落地“具体功能”目标:按设计方案完成功能开发,保证代码质量与进度可控。1.任务拆分与排期任务:将开发任务拆分为可执行单元,分配人员并制定时间计划。操作:项目经理联合研发负责人*,基于技术方案拆分任务(例:“用户注册模块”拆分为“前端表单开发”“后端接口开发”“数据库表创建”);使用甘特图(如Project/Teambition)排期,明确任务起止时间、依赖关系(例:“前端开发依赖接口文档评审通过”);输出《开发任务清单》,包含任务ID、名称、负责人、工期、前置条件。输出物:《开发任务清单》《项目甘特图》。2.代码开发与自测任务:开发人员编码实现功能,并进行初步测试。操作:编码规范:遵循团队《代码规范手册》(如命名规则、注释要求),使用Git进行版本管理;单元测试:开发人员对核心功能编写单元测试(JUnit/Jest),覆盖率达到80%以上;每日站会:项目经理组织15分钟站会,同步“昨天完成什么、今天计划什么、遇到什么问题”。输出物:可运行的开发分支、单元测试报告、《每日站会纪要》。3.代码评审任务:检查代码质量,规避潜在风险。操作:评审方式:同行评审(3-5名研发人员)+架构师评审(重点检查架构合理性);评审内容:代码逻辑、功能优化点、安全性(如SQL注入防范)、可维护性;问题整改:针对评审问题,开发人员需在24小时内修复,并反馈结果。输出物:《代码评审报告》《问题整改跟踪表》。(四)测试验证阶段:保证“质量达标”目标:通过系统测试验证功能、功能、兼容性等,保证产品符合需求标准。1.测试计划与用例设计任务:制定测试策略,设计测试用例。操作:测试计划:测试负责人编写《测试计划》,明确测试范围(功能/功能/安全)、测试环境(测试服/预发服)、测试资源(人力/工具);测试用例:基于PRD和设计稿,设计等价类、边界值、场景用例(例:“注册手机号输入11位数字,成功;输入10位,提示错误”);用例评审:联合产品、研发评审用例,保证覆盖核心场景。输出物:《测试计划》《测试用例集》《用例评审报告》。2.测试执行与缺陷管理任务:执行测试,跟踪并修复缺陷。操作:功能测试:按测试用例逐项验证,记录缺陷(使用Jira/禅道),标注严重级别(致命/严重/一般/轻微);回归测试:修复缺陷后,验证相关功能是否受影响;缺陷跟踪:测试负责人每日同步缺陷状态,保证“严重缺陷24小时内修复,一般缺陷3天内修复”。输出物:《测试执行报告》《缺陷跟踪表》(含缺陷ID、描述、严重级别、负责人、修复状态)。3.验收测试任务:业务方确认产品是否满足需求,准予上线。操作:验收标准:对照PRD验收标准逐项核对(例:“支付成功率≥99.9%”);用户验收:邀请业务方代表或种子用户进行UAT测试,收集反馈并整改;输出签字确认的《验收测试报告》。输出物:《验收测试报告》。(五)上线发布阶段:实现“产品落地”目标:安全、平稳将产品发布至生产环境,保证用户可正常使用。1.上线准备任务:完成上线前检查,制定发布方案。操作:环境检查:运维工程师确认生产环境配置(服务器、数据库、缓存)与测试环境一致;发布方案:明确发布时间(如凌晨低峰期)、回滚机制(如“发布失败后30分钟内回滚至上版本”)、灰度策略(如“先开放10%用户流量”);风险预案:制定应急预案(如“服务器宕机时切换备用服务器”)。输出物:《上线检查清单》《发布方案》《应急预案》。2.上线执行与监控任务:按计划发布产品,实时监控运行状态。操作:发布实施:运维工程师执行发布脚本,研发负责人现场支持;监控指标:通过监控系统(如Prometheus)监控CPU、内存、接口响应时间、错误率;问题响应:若出现异常(如错误率突增),立即启动回滚流程,并通知相关团队。输出物:《上线记录表》《发布监控报告》。(六)复盘优化阶段:沉淀“经验教训”目标:总结项目得失,优化后续开发流程,提升团队能力。1.复盘会议任务:组织跨部门复盘,分析成功经验与待改进点。操作:参与人员:项目核心成员(产品、研发、测试、设计、项目经理*);复盘内容:目标达成情况(如“是否按时上线”“是否达成留存率目标”)、问题根因(如“需求变更频繁导致延期”)、改进措施(如“建立需求变更评审机制”);输出《项目复盘报告》,明确“做得好的3点”“待改进的3点”“下一步行动”。输出物:《项目复盘报告》。2.知识沉淀任务:将项目文档、经验教训归档,形成组织资产。操作:文档归档:将PRD、设计稿、测试用例、复盘报告等存入共享文档库(如Confluence);流程优化:根据复盘结果,更新《产品开发流程手册》《需求变更管理规范》等制度。输出物:《知识库目录》《优化后的流程文档》。三、核心工具模板清单以下为各阶段关键模板的简化版,可根据团队需求调整字段:(一)需求分析阶段1.《产品需求文档(PRD)》模板章节内容要点文档信息文档版本、修订日期、作者、审核人需求背景用户痛点、业务目标、市场机会用户画像目标用户特征(年龄、职业、使用场景)功能详述用户故事(“作为…,我希望…,以便…”)、功能流程图、原型图截图、页面元素说明非功能需求功能(响应时间≤2s)、安全(数据加密)、兼容性(支持iOS14+、Android8+)验收标准量化指标(例:“注册转化率≥80%”“错误提示准确率100%”)附件竞品分析报告、用户调研数据2.《需求变更记录表》模板变更ID变更内容变更原因提出人影响评估(进度/成本/范围)审批人状态(待审批/已批准/已拒绝)备注(二)开发实施阶段《开发任务清单》模板任务ID任务名称所属模块负责人工期(天)开始时间结束时间前置任务ID状态(待开始/进行中/已完成)(三)测试验证阶段《缺陷跟踪表》模板缺陷ID所属模块缺陷描述严重级别负责人发觉时间修复时间状态(新建/修复中/已验证/已关闭)复现步骤(四)上线发布阶段《上线检查清单》模板检查项检查内容责任人检查结果(通过/不通过)备注服务器环境CPU/内存使用率≤80%运维工程师数据库数据备份完成,与测试环境一致DBA功能完整性核心功能可正常使用测试负责人监控系统日志、告警配置正常运维工程师四、关键注意事项与风险规避(一)需求管理:避免“需求蔓延”变更控制:需求变更需提交《需求变更申请》,评估影响后由产品经理、研发负责人、项目经理*联合审批,严禁口头或临时变更;需求冻结:进入开发阶段后,非紧急需求(如影响上线进度)一律延至下个迭代。(二)团队协作:强化“跨部门沟通”定期同步:每日站会(15分钟)、每周项目例会(1小时),使用共享文档(如飞书文档)同步进度;责任到人:每个任务明确“唯一负责人”,避免多人负责导致推诿。(三)风险控制:提前“识别与预案”风险清单:项目启动时识别潜在风险(如“核心研发人员离职”“第三方接口延迟”),制定应对预案(如“备份人员培养”“提前
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 化工厂充装人员课件培训
- 《汽车文化》课件 第二章 汽车基本结构 第一节 汽车的分类
- 福建省泉州市第五中学2025-2026学年上学期期末七年级数学试卷(无答案)
- 2026年陕西省西安市碑林区西北工大附中中考数学第一次适应性试卷(含简略答案)
- 2026年度牛市下半场实物再通胀
- 钢结构焊接材料选用技术要点
- 2026年上半年黑龙江事业单位联考省人民政府黑瞎子岛建设和管理委员会招聘4人备考考试题库及答案解析
- 2026内蒙古鄂尔多斯市城投商业运营管理有限公司招聘46人参考考试题库及答案解析
- 市场调研公司数据管理制度
- 2026湖南株洲市天元中学招聘编外合同制教师考试备考试题及答案解析
- 电磁辐射环境下的职业健康防护
- 中药外洗治疗化疗导致外周神经毒课件
- 2025-2026学年人教版(新教材)小学数学三年级下册(全册)教学设计(附目录P208)
- 2025版中国慢性乙型肝炎防治指南
- 2026年及未来5年市场数据中国草酸行业发展前景预测及投资战略数据分析研究报告
- 感染科结核病防治培训指南
- 金属水幕施工方案(3篇)
- 2025美国心脏协会心肺复苏(CPR)与心血管急救(ECC)指南解读
- 2024-2025学年浙江省金华市兰溪市一年级(上)期末数学试卷
- 广东省珠海市香洲区2023-2024学年八年级上学期语文期末试卷(含答案)
- 2025年青海省辅警考试公安基础知识考试真题库及参考答案
评论
0/150
提交评论